• Title/Summary/Keyword: 컴퓨팅 사고기반 융합

Search Result 38, Processing Time 0.024 seconds

Developing a Learning Model based on Computational Thinking (컴퓨팅 사고기반 융합 수업모델 개발)

  • Yu, Jeong-Su;Jang, Yong-Woo
    • Journal of Industrial Convergence
    • /
    • v.20 no.2
    • /
    • pp.29-36
    • /
    • 2022
  • Computational thinking in the AI and Big Data era for digital society means a series of problem-solving methods that involve expressing problems and their solutions in ways that computers can execute. Computational thinking is an approach to solving problems, designing systems, and understanding human behavior by deriving basic concepts in computer science, and solving difficult problems and elusive puzzles for students. We recently studied 93 pre-service teachers who are currently a freshman at ◯◯ university. The results of the first semester class, the participants created a satisfactory algorithm of the video level. Also, the proposed model was found to contribute greatly to the understanding of the computational thinking of the students participating in the class.

A Study on the Development of Digital Yut Playing System Based on Physical Computing (피지컬 컴퓨팅을 기반으로 한 디지털 윷놀이 시스템 개발에 관한 연구)

  • Koh, Byoungoh
    • Journal of The Korean Association of Information Education
    • /
    • v.21 no.3
    • /
    • pp.335-342
    • /
    • 2017
  • The artificial intelligence, robot technology, Internet of things, and life sciences that create added value while dramatically transforming human life have been highlighted in the fourth industrial revolution, the next industrial revolution. In order to adapt to the 4th industry, it is necessary to educate students to develop fusion thinking and computing thinking ability. Therefore, in this study, we developed a digital Yut Playing system based on physical computing, reflecting STEAM and decomposition, pattern recognition, abstraction, and algorithm design, which are components of computing thinking. By experiencing the developed system and applying it to education, it raised interest and interest in programming education and improved programming lesson for fusion thinking and computing thinking ability.

Designing an App Inventor Curriculum for Computational Thinking based Non-majors Software Education (컴퓨팅 사고 기반의 비전공자 소프트웨어 교육을 위한 앱 인벤터 교육과정 설계)

  • Ku, Jin-Hee
    • Journal of Convergence for Information Technology
    • /
    • v.7 no.1
    • /
    • pp.61-66
    • /
    • 2017
  • As the fourth industrial revolution becomes more popular and advanced services such as artificial intelligence and Internet of Things technology are widely commercialized, awareness of the importance of software is spreading. Recently, software education has been taught not only in elementary school and college but also in college. Also, there is a growing interest in computational thinking needed to solve problems through computing methodology and model. The purpose of this study is to design an app inventor course for non-majors software education based on computational thinking. As a result of the study, six detailed competencies of computational thinking were derived, and six detailed competencies were mapped to the app inventor learning elements. In addition, based on the computational thinking modeling, I designed an app inventor class for students who participated in IT curriculum of university liberal arts curriculum.

The Effect of Physical Computing Education to Improve the Convergence Capability of Secondary Mathematics-Science Gifted Students (중등 수학과학 영재를 위한 피지컬컴퓨팅 교육이 융합적 역량 향상에 미치는 영향)

  • Kim, Jihyun;Kim, Taeyoung
    • The Journal of Korean Association of Computer Education
    • /
    • v.19 no.2
    • /
    • pp.87-98
    • /
    • 2016
  • Our study is composed of Arduino robot assembly, board connecting and collaborative programming learning, and it is to evaluate their effect on improving secondary mathematics-science gifted students' convergence capability. Research results show that interpersonal skills, information-scientific creativity and integrative thinking disposition are improved. Further, by analyzing the relationship between the sub-elements of each thinking element, persistence and imagination for solving problems, interest of scientific information, openness, sense of adventure, a logical attitude, communication, productive skepticism and so on are extracted as important factors in convergence learning. Thus, as the result of our study, we know that gifted students conducted various thinking activities in their learning process to solve the problem, and it can be seen that convergence competencies are also improved significantly.

Development and Application of Educational Contents for Software Education based on the Integrative Production for Increasing the IT Competence of Elementary Students (초등학생의 미래 IT역량 강화를 위한 융합적 산출물 기반 소프트웨어 교육용 콘텐츠 개발 및 적용)

  • Seo, Jeonghyun;Kim, Yungsik
    • Journal of The Korean Association of Information Education
    • /
    • v.20 no.4
    • /
    • pp.357-366
    • /
    • 2016
  • The ability of computational thinking is a key competence that person of talent in the future should keep. Computational thinking is a serial process in which a problem is defined in context of computing, stages of abstraction are processed in order to find the efficient solution, the most appropriate process and resources for a solution are selected and combined through algorithms which use various concepts, principles and methods for automatic implementation of abstract concepts. It needs appropriate learning content in stage of elementary school. This study has verified the effect it made on improvement of learner's creative personality by developing and applying the educational content for software education based on the integrative production. The result of study confirmed that learning through the educational content for software education based on the integrative production affects improvement on learner's creativity positively and suggested a method of applying it to computing education in elementary school.

Application of design thinking-based maker education program for elementary school students' software education (초등학생의 소프트웨어교육을 위한 디자인사고 기반 메이커교육 프로그램 적용)

  • Lee, Saet-Byeol;Lee, Seung-Chul;Kim, Tae-Young
    • Proceedings of The KACE
    • /
    • 2018.08a
    • /
    • pp.129-132
    • /
    • 2018
  • 미래사회가 요구하는 창의융합형 인재 육성을 위한 기초소양 함양을 위해 소프트웨어 교육이 의무화되는 등 컴퓨팅 사고력과 지능정보사회에 필요한 핵심역량인 협력적 문제해결력의 향상을 위한 소프트웨어 교육에서의 교수 학습 방법이 강조되고 있다. 이에 따라 본 연구에서는 감성적 사고와 창의적 사고력의 균형을 추구하는 디자인 사고와 실생활 맥락적 문제를 해결하는 메이커 활동을 결합한 디자인 사고 기반 메이커교육을 소프트웨어 교육에 적용하여 초등학생의 협력적 문제해결력에 미치는 영향을 검증하고자 한다. 이를 통하여 디자인 사고기반 메이커 교육의 학습효과를 밝히고, 초등학교 수업에서 다른 교과목과 융합한 소프트웨어 교육의 적용방법에 대한 시사점을 제공하고자 한다.

  • PDF

Effects of Physical Computing Education Using App Inventor and Arduino on Industrial High School Students' Creative and Integrative Thinking (앱 인벤터와 아두이노를 이용한 피지컬 컴퓨팅 교육이 공업계 고등학생의 창의·융합적 사고에 미치는 영향)

  • Choi, Sook-Young;Kim, Semin
    • The Journal of Korean Association of Computer Education
    • /
    • v.19 no.6
    • /
    • pp.45-54
    • /
    • 2016
  • The purpose of this study is to investigate the effects of Android application programming education to control Arduino using App Inventor on industrial high school students' creative and integrative thinking ability. We developed an instructional content based on integrative learning and creative problem-solving model and taught a class on it. The result of this study showed that there was a significant improvement in divergent thinking and motivation items among the sub elements of creative problem solving. In addition, students' survey on the integrated thinking has shown that many students think that they could design an IoT system applied to everyday life based on the knowledge they have learned in this class. Therefore, it can be confirmed that physical computing education using App Inventor and Arduino has a positive effect on students' creative and integrative thinking ability.

The Effects of Educational Robot-based SW Convergence Education on Primary Students' Computational Thinking, Collaborative and Communication Skills (교육용로봇기반 SW융합교육이 초등학생의 컴퓨팅 사고력, 협업능력 및 의사소통능력에 미치는 효과)

  • Choi, Hyungshin;Lee, Jeongmin
    • Journal of The Korean Association of Information Education
    • /
    • v.24 no.2
    • /
    • pp.131-138
    • /
    • 2020
  • The aim of software education is to increase students' Computational Thinking(CT) skills that they can compose problems and provide solutions which can be carried out effectively by information-processing systems. Furthermore, if problem solving situations can provide students with meaningful problem solving opportunities in authentic social contexts, then software education would be more valuable. This study pursued educational robot-based SW convergence education where 4th grade primary students have access to tangible outputs and can engage in authentic problem solving situations working with peers by using robots and programming. In addition, this study investigated the effectiveness of the classes in terms of computational thinking skills and social capabilities(collaborative skills and communication skills). The current study provides educational robot-based SW convergence education cases of a primary school and discusses the effectiveness of the classes in terms of students' computational thinking skills and social capabilities.

A Study on the Diagnosis Method of Knowledge Information in Computational Thinking using LightBot (라이트봇을 활용한 컴퓨팅 사고력에서 지식 정보의 진단 방안에 관한 연구)

  • Lee, Youngseok
    • Journal of the Korea Convergence Society
    • /
    • v.11 no.8
    • /
    • pp.33-38
    • /
    • 2020
  • Modern society needs to think in new directions and solve problems by grafting problems from diverse fields with computers. Abstraction and automation of various problems using computing technology with your own ideas is called computational thinking. In this paper, we analyze how to diagnose and improve knowledge information based on computational thinking through the process of presenting a variety of problems in programming education situations and finding several problem-solving methods to solve them. To pretest the learners, they were diagnosed using a measurement sheet and a LightBot. By determining the correlation between the evaluation results and LightBot results, the learners' current knowledge statuses were checked, and the correlation between the evaluation results and the LightBot results, based on what was taught according to the problem-solving learning technique, was analyzed according to the proposed technique. The analysis of the group average score of the learners showed that the learning effect was significant. If the method of deriving and improving knowledge based on computational thinking ability for solving the problem proposed in this paper is applied to software education, it will induce student interest, thereby increasing the learning effect.

Development of Rubric for Assessing Computational Thinking Concepts and Programming Ability (컴퓨팅 사고 개념 학습과 프로그래밍 역량 평가를 위한 루브릭 개발)

  • Kim, Jae-Kyung
    • The Journal of Korean Association of Computer Education
    • /
    • v.20 no.6
    • /
    • pp.27-36
    • /
    • 2017
  • Today, a computational thinking course is being introduced in elementary, secondary and higher education curriculums. It is important to encourage a creative talent built on convergence of computational thinking and various major fields. However, proper analysis and evaluation of computational thinking assessment tools in higher education are currently not sufficient. In this study, we developed a rubric to evaluate computational thinking skills in university class from two perspectives: conceptual learning and practical programming training. Moreover, learning achievement and relevance between theory and practice were assessed. The proposed rubric is based on Computational Thinking Practices for assessing the higher education curriculum, and it is defined as a two-level structure which consists of four categories and eight items. The proposed rubric has been applied to a liberal art class in university, and the results were discussed to make future improvements.